Call number: RD30.P8 C66 1799. Manuscript containing lecture notes on surgery copied after Pott's death, dated 1799 on title. The book was subsequently used by several others through the 19th century, containing notes concerning current events, recipes, travel, plants, literary quotes, short original pieces, and more. The book was subsequently re-purposed as a scrapbook, with clippings pasted to many pages (sometimes over handwritten entries) and a large quantity of pages in the middle of the book left blank.
